How to Choose Colors That Go With Blue

When it comes to colors that go with blue, the options are almost endless. From bright and bold shades of yellow to softer and more subtle hues of gray, there are many colors that work well with blue. The key is to find a balance between colors that compliment each other without creating too much of a contrast.

The most important thing to keep in mind when selecting colors that go with blue is to consider how much contrast you want between the two colors. If you want a more subtle effect, choose colors that are close in tone or shades of the same color. For example, a light shade of blue can pair nicely with a medium gray or a pale yellow. However, if you’re looking for more of a bold, vibrant look, you can choose colors that have a bigger contrast such as navy blue and bright yellow.

The next thing to consider is the size of the room. If you have a small space, you may want to stick with lighter colors to make the room appear larger. On the other hand, if you have a large room, you can use darker colors to create more of a cozy atmosphere.

Popular Colors That Go With Blue

There are a few popular colors go with blue that are sure to give your space a chic, modern look. One of the most classic combinations is blue and white. This combination is perfect for creating a crisp, clean look that’s perfect for any room. Another popular choice is navy blue and yellow. This bold pairing creates a vivid contrast that adds a lot of visual interest to the room.

Other popular colors pair with blue include light gray, coral, olive green, and pink. Each of these colors pairs beautifully with blue and can help you create a unique look for your space.

How to Use Colors Go With Blue – in Home Décor

Once you’ve chosen your colors, it’s time to start incorporating them into your home décor. One of the easiest ways to do this is by choosing furniture and accessories in those colors. For example, you could choose a navy blue sofa with bright yellow throw pillows or a light gray armchair with a blue ottoman.

You can also add pops of color with artwork and accent pieces. Look for wall hangings, rugs, and vases in the colors you’ve chosen. This is a great way to add a bit of personality to your room and tie all the colors together.

Tips for Choosing Colors That Go With Blue

It’s important to take your time and experiment with different combinations. Don’t be afraid to think outside the box and try something unexpected. Color is all about personal preference, so don’t be afraid to mix and match until you find the perfect combination for your space.

It’s also a good idea to pay attention to the lighting in the room. Different types of lighting can change the way colors appear, so make sure to view your colors in both natural and artificial light before making any decisions.
